## Anti-Loss Protocol
**WARNING:** Starknet uses account abstraction (starknet-alpha addresses start with 0x but are NOT EVM-compatible). If you send ETH directly from Ethereum mainnet to a Starknet address using a standard ETH transfer, your funds will be lost. You MUST use a Starknet-compatible bridge.
**ALWAYS** confirm the bridge shows your Starknet wallet address (not your EVM address) before approving any transaction.

## Method 1: Official StarkGate Bridge (RECOMMENDED)
StarkGate is Starknet's official bridge contract, audited and maintained by StarkWare.
**Steps:**
1. Go to [starkgate.starknet.io](https://starkgate.starknet.io).
2. Connect your EVM wallet (MetaMask, Coinbase Wallet) AND your Starknet wallet (Argent X or Braavos).
3. Select ETH or USDC as the asset to bridge.
4. Enter the amount.
5. Confirm transaction on Ethereum side.
6. Wait 10-30 minutes for the L1 to L2 message to propagate.
7. Your funds will appear in your Starknet wallet.
**Pro tip:** StarkGate only supports ETH and USDC natively. For other tokens, bridge USDC first then swap on Starknet (on JediSwap or mySwap).
## Method 2: Layerswap (CHEAPEST from CEX)
If your funds are on Coinbase, Binance, Kraken, or another CEX, Layerswap lets you send directly to Starknet without paying Ethereum gas.
**Steps:**
1. Go to [layerswap.io](https://layerswap.io).
2. Select source: your exchange (Coinbase, Binance, etc.).
3. Select destination: Starknet and paste your Starknet wallet address.
4. Enter amount and confirm.
5. Complete the exchange withdrawal (Layerswap handles the routing).
6. Funds arrive on Starknet in 5-15 minutes.
**Cost:** Usually under $1 -- this is by far the cheapest route.

## Important Warnings
1. **Starknet accounts need activation.** If this is your first time receiving on Starknet, your wallet must be activated on the network first. Argent X handles this automatically. Braavos requires a one-time setup transaction.
2. **You need ETH on Starknet for gas.** After bridging, you still need a small amount of ETH on Starknet to transact. Bridge at least $5 to $10 worth of ETH extra to cover initial gas.
3. **USDC.e vs USDC on Starknet:** Starknet has both a bridged version (USDC.e) and a native USDC. Most DeFi protocols accept both, but verify before providing liquidity.
## How to Add Starknet to Your Wallet
MetaMask does NOT natively support Starknet (it is non-EVM). You need a dedicated wallet:
- **Argent X** (Browser + Mobile): [argent.xyz](https://argent.xyz)
- **Braavos** (Browser + Mobile): [braavos.app](https://braavos.app)
Both are non-custodial and fully Starknet-native. Set up before bridging.
## Common Mistakes
- **Sending ETH directly to a Starknet address from MetaMask.** This will not work. Always use a bridge.
- **Bridging ERC-20 tokens StarkGate does not support.** Check the supported assets list first. Bridge USDC or ETH, then swap on Starknet DEXs.
- **Forgetting to keep gas ETH on Starknet.** You cannot move bridged USDC if you have zero ETH on Starknet for gas.
- **Using old deprecated bridges.** Starknet deprecated several 2024-era bridges. Stick to StarkGate, Orbiter, Across, or Layerswap.
